Use the following passage for the questions based on it.

There are six flats on a floor in two rows. Out of these, three are north facing and the other three are south facing flats. The flats are to be allotted amongst Arun, Biswajyot, Chitra, Derek, Evan and Fatima. Biswajyot gets a north facing flat and is not next to Derek. Derek and Fatima get diagonally opposite flats. Chitra is next to Fatima, and gets a south facing flat. Evan gets a north facing flat.

Except Derek and Fatima, which other pair is diagonally opposite to each other?
Correct Answer
Arun and Biswajyot

💡 Analysis & Explanation
Spatial Mapping Setup
There are two rows. South-facing flats are situated in the Northern row, looking South. North-facing flats are in the Southern row, looking North.
South-Facing (Row 1) Alignment
We know Chitra (C) is next to Fatima (F) and both are in the South-facing row. This row contains F, C, and Arun (A) by elimination.
North-Facing (Row 2) Alignment
Biswajyot (B) and Evan (E) are North-facing. B is not next to Derek (D), so E must be placed right in the middle between B and D to separate them. The layout for this row is B-E-D.
Diagonal Matching
Since F and D are diagonally opposite, if D is at the right end of the North-facing row, F must be at the extreme left end of the South-facing row. The layout becomes (F-C-A) opposite to (B-E-D).
Conclusion
The extreme opposite ends now pair Arun (A) and Biswajyot (B) perfectly diagonally across from each other.
